im社交聊天软件如何实现匿名聊天?

在当今互联网时代,社交聊天软件已经成为人们日常交流的重要工具。然而,由于隐私保护意识的增强,越来越多的人开始关注如何在社交聊天软件中实现匿名聊天。本文将围绕这一主题,从技术手段、平台策略以及用户心理等方面,探讨如何实现匿名聊天。

一、技术手段

  1. 加密技术

加密技术是保障匿名聊天安全的重要手段。在社交聊天软件中,可以通过以下几种加密方式实现匿名聊天:

(1)端到端加密:在客户端和服务器之间建立加密通道,确保聊天内容在传输过程中不被第三方窃取和篡改。

(2)数据加密:对聊天数据进行加密处理,使得聊天内容无法被轻易解读。

(3)匿名通信协议:采用匿名通信协议,如Tor、I2P等,为用户构建一个安全的匿名网络环境。


  1. 匿名认证

为了实现匿名聊天,社交聊天软件需要提供匿名认证功能。以下几种认证方式可供参考:

(1)虚拟身份:用户在注册时,可以使用虚拟身份,如昵称、头像等,避免真实身份泄露。

(2)匿名认证码:用户在登录时,输入匿名认证码,确保身份不被识别。

(3)多因素认证:结合密码、手机验证码、指纹等多种认证方式,提高匿名聊天安全性。


  1. IP地址隐藏

为了保护用户隐私,社交聊天软件可以采用以下方法隐藏用户IP地址:

(1)代理服务器:用户通过代理服务器访问聊天软件,将真实IP地址替换为代理服务器IP地址。

(2)VPN:用户使用VPN连接到服务器,实现IP地址隐藏。

二、平台策略

  1. 隐私保护政策

社交聊天软件应制定严格的隐私保护政策,明确用户隐私信息的收集、存储、使用和分享原则,确保用户在匿名聊天过程中,其隐私得到充分保护。


  1. 内容审核机制

为了防止匿名聊天被滥用,社交聊天软件应建立完善的内容审核机制,对聊天内容进行实时监控和审查,对违规行为进行处罚。


  1. 用户教育

社交聊天软件应加强对用户的教育,提高用户对匿名聊天的认识,引导用户正确使用匿名聊天功能,避免造成不良影响。

三、用户心理

  1. 安全感需求

用户选择匿名聊天的首要原因是出于对自身安全的考虑。在匿名聊天过程中,用户可以放松心理防线,畅所欲言。


  1. 隐私保护意识

随着网络安全意识的提高,越来越多的用户开始关注个人隐私保护。匿名聊天能够满足用户对隐私保护的需求。


  1. 社交需求

在匿名聊天环境中,用户可以自由表达自己的想法,拓展社交圈子,满足社交需求。

总结

实现匿名聊天是社交聊天软件在保护用户隐私方面的重要举措。通过技术手段、平台策略以及用户心理等方面的综合考虑,社交聊天软件可以构建一个安全、健康的匿名聊天环境,满足用户在隐私保护、社交需求等方面的需求。然而,在实现匿名聊天的过程中,仍需注意以下问题:

  1. 平衡隐私保护与监管需求:在保障用户隐私的同时,社交聊天软件应积极配合相关部门的监管工作,防止匿名聊天被滥用。

  2. 持续优化技术手段:随着网络安全技术的不断发展,社交聊天软件应不断优化技术手段,提高匿名聊天的安全性。

  3. 加强用户教育:提高用户对匿名聊天的认识,引导用户正确使用匿名聊天功能,共同维护网络环境的健康和谐。

猜你喜欢:即时通讯系统